#spd_positions .form textarea{ width:500px; height:100px; }
#spd_positions .field_example{ line-height:1;}
#spd_positions .field_examples{ margin:10px 4px 0 4px; padding:10px 0 0; width:500px; line-height:1; border:1px dashed #CCC;border-width:1px 0 1px 0;}
#spd_positions #in_record_form { padding:10px; margin:0 0 15px 0;background-color:#EFEFEF; border:1px solid #DDD; -moz-border-radius: 5px;}
#spd_positions #in_record_form dd label{width:150px;}
table#record_pricing{border:1px solid #CCC;}
table#record_pricing th.rp_first{width:70px;}
#record_pricing th{background:none;color:#000;line-height:1.7;}
#bodyarea #record_pricing td{ border-top:1px solid #CCC;margin:0;padding:0;line-height:1.7;}
#spd_positions dd { line-height:3;}
#spd_positions dd label{float:left; width:150px; font-weight:bold;}
#spd_positions label span.required{ margin-right:3px; }
#spd_positions dd span{font-style:italic;}
#spd_positions #work_type_other{ margin-left:170px; font-weight:bold; }
#spd_positions #work_type_other span{font-style:normal;}
#spd_positions .actionWrapper{text-align:center;}
#spd_positions #Assistance .leftAssistance, #spd_positions #Assistance .rightAssistance{ float:left; width:40%; margin:20px 2.5%; padding:1%; border:1px solid #DEDEDE;}
#spd_positions .topbar{ background: transparent url(/images/extensions/adventistemployment/ae_logo.gif) top right no-repeat;min-height:80px;padding-right:150px;}

/** SHOW **/
#position-preview{ margin-top:10px; padding-bottom:10px;height:100px;}
#position-preview .position-photo, #position-preview .position-abstract {float:left;}
#position-preview .position-photo{width:120px;min-height:100px;}
#position-preview .position-abstract{ width:400px;padding-left:0;}
#position-preview .position-abstract p { padding:4px 0;}
#position-content{ clear:both;margin-left:120px;line-height:1;}
#bodyarea #position-preview ul{ list-style-type:none;margin:0;padding:0;}
#bodyarea #position-preview ul li{ margin:0;}
#spd_positions dl.position-info dt{margin:0;line-height:2;}
#spd_positions dl.position-info dd{margin:0;line-height:1.5;}

/** Partial **/
.vacant-position-preview .clear{clear:both;}
#bodyarea .vacant-position-preview, .vp-short-end{border-bottom:1px dashed #CCC;margin-top:10px;padding-bottom:10px;}
.vacant-position-preview .vacant-position-photo, .vacant-position-preview .vacant-position-abstract {float:left;}
.vacant-position-preview .vacant-position-photo{width:120px;height:100px;text-align:center;}
#bodyarea .vacant-position-preview .vacant-position-abstract{ width:400px;}
#bodyarea .vacant-position-preview .vacant-position-abstract p {padding:4px 0;}
#bodyarea .vacant-position-preview h4{ margin:0;padding:0 0 14px 0; border:0;line-height:1.3;}
#bodyarea .vacant-position-applications_close{ font-style:italic;}
#bodyarea .vacant-position-description{ font-weight:bold;padding:2px 0;}
.vp-employer{font-weight:bold;}

/* Widget */
.vacant-position-preview .vacant-position-abstract{ width:auto;}
.adventistemployment-adventist-employment-widget h3{margin-bottom:20px;}
.adventistemployment-adventist-employment-widget h4{margin:5px 0 13px 0;font-weight:bold;}
.adventistemployment-adventist-employment-widget p{margin:2px;}